Kenneth E. Malenchini passed away at his home in New Hampshire on Sunday July 21, 2013. He was 85 years of age. Mr. Malenchini was born in Melrose to the late Aristide & Mary (Robinson) Malenchini, was raised and educated in Melrose and lived in Melrose most of his life. Ken entered the U.S. Navy and served his country with pride during WWII. After his discharge from the Armed Forces he worked at Sears & Roebuck for a few years, for the City of Melrose public works department in the sewer division before becoming the superintendant of Wyoming Cemetery. Mr. Malenchini then went on to work at the Wang Company with the computer supply team for 10 years. Ken loved spending time with his family, enjoyed fishing and hunting and enjoyed the trips he took to Switzerland and Rome. He has been a resident of Hooksett, NH for the past 10 years.
